Think the CW requirement is eliminated? Think again! Cw is still required
for:
1. Any Novice or Technician transmitting on 80m (3525-3600)
1.a.) Novices and Technicians are not required to transmit on 80m
(3525-3600).
2. Any Novice or Technician transmitting on 40m (7025-7125)
2.a.) Novices and Technicians are not required to transmit on 40m
(7025-7125).
3. Any Novice or Technician transmitting on 15m (21025-21200)
3.a.) Novices and Technicians are not required to transmit on 15m
(21025-21200).
4. ANY amateur transmitting on 50.0 - 50.1 MHz
4.a.) Novices and Technicians are not required to transmit on
50000-50100.
5. ANY amateur transmitting on 144.0 - 144.1 MHz
5.a.) Novices and Technicians are not required to transmit on
144000-144100.
